Output 666689481d4e6615b59ec35d8274c31e88431413181b8c922f68d5327b52be39:24

value
5495462
script pubkey
OP_0 OP_PUSHBYTES_20 6b3670d102fdb82526fc728d96c81d0fba9d3777
address
bc1qdvm8p5gzlkuz2fhuw2xedjqap7af6dmhluplrh
transaction
666689481d4e6615b59ec35d8274c31e88431413181b8c922f68d5327b52be39
spent
true